A contactless outlet for dc distribution systems is proposed. It uses an inductive contactless power transfer circuit with a series/parallel compensation circuit to prevent voltage fluctuation. However, the output voltage of the circuit rises in light load conditions. In this paper, the main circuit and control method for reducing the rise in output voltage and a method of estimating the output voltage are presented. The proposed circuit and methods were verified and evaluated experimentally using feedback control. (C) 2015 Wiley Periodicals, Inc.
